package google.registry.model.ofy;
import static com.google.common.collect.ImmutableList.toImmutableList;
import static com.googlecode.objectify.ObjectifyService.ofy;
import com.google.common.collect.ImmutableList;
import com.google.common.collect.Streams;
import com.googlecode.objectify.Key;
import com.googlecode.objectify.Result;
import com.googlecode.objectify.cmd.DeleteType;
import com.googlecode.objectify.cmd.Deleter;
import java.util.Arrays;
import java.util.stream.Stream;
/**
* A Deleter that forwards to {@code ofy().delete()}, but can be augmented via subclassing to
* do custom processing on the keys to be deleted prior to their deletion.
*/
abstract class AugmentedDeleter implements Deleter {
private final Deleter delegate = ofy().delete();
/** Extension method to allow this Deleter to do extra work prior to the actual delete. */
protected abstract void handleDeletion(Iterable<Key<?>> keys);
private void handleDeletionStream(Stream<?> entityStream) {
handleDeletion(entityStream.map(Key::create).collect(toImmutableList()));
}
@Override
public Result<Void> entities(Iterable<?> entities) {
handleDeletionStream(Streams.stream(entities));
return delegate.entities(entities);
}
@Override
public Result<Void> entities(Object... entities) {
handleDeletionStream(Arrays.stream(entities));
return delegate.entities(entities);
}
@Override
public Result<Void> entity(Object entity) {
handleDeletionStream(Stream.of(entity));
return delegate.entity(entity);
}
@Override
public Result<Void> key(Key<?> key) {
handleDeletion(Arrays.asList(key));
return delegate.keys(key);
}
@Override
public Result<Void> keys(Iterable<? extends Key<?>> keys) {
// Magic to convert the type Iterable<? extends Key<?>> (a family of types which allows for
// homogeneous iterables of a fixed Key<T> type, e.g. List<Key<Lock>>, and is convenient for
// callers) into the type Iterable<Key<?>> (a concrete type of heterogeneous keys, which is
// convenient for users).
handleDeletion(ImmutableList.copyOf(keys));
return delegate.keys(keys);
}
@Override
public Result<Void> keys(Key<?>... keys) {
handleDeletion(Arrays.asList(keys));
return delegate.keys(keys);
}
/** Augmenting this gets ugly; you can always just use keys(Key.create(...)) instead. */
@Override
public DeleteType type(Class<?> clazz) {
throw new UnsupportedOperationException();
}
}
